Other contributors to joint deterioration [in concrete highways and streets] include poor joint sealant maintenance, improper installation or poor maintenance of metal or plastic inserts, high reinforcing steel, subbase-pumping, dowel-socketing, and keyway failure. These are design or construction errors that create locally weak areas that spall easily.

Des tirants d'acier ou barres de liaison, de 75 à 90 cm de longueur et espacés de 0,75 m centre à centre, tiennent les voies ensemble. En plus des tirants placés au centre de la dalle, une rainure ou une clef assure le transfert des charges d'une dalle à l'autre, dans le cas de la construction successive de deux voies adjacentes.
